Life
Life has no meaning, the moment you lose the illusion of being eternal.
- Jean Paul Sartre
Life isn't about waiting for the storm to pass...It's about learning to dance in the rain.
- Vivian Greene
This new life is endless, and even after my physical death it will be kept alive by those who live the life of complete renunciation of falsehood, lies, hatred, anger, greed and lust and who, to accomplish all this, do no lustful actions, do no harm to anyone.
- A Spiritual Leader
I believe when life gives you lemons, you should make lemonade...and try to find someone whose life has given them vodka, and have a party.
- Ron White
There are two tragedies in life. One is to lose your heart's desire. The other is to gain it.
- George Bernard Shaw
There are those who spend their lives arguing which is better, the crescent moon or the full. Then there are a few who revel in both for they know The Moon is One.
- Quran
The existence of life and its beauty, both are hidden in the "uncertainties" of
life.
- Deep Trivedi
Life is only the present. And in the present, neither there is room for memories of
the past nor worries of the future. The root cause of all the miseries of life is the
effort to accommodate the past or future in the present.
- Deep Trivedi
Life only begins to be an adventure when we cease living it for ourselves.
- Joel S. Goldsmith
Every chapter in the Book of Life defines our character and tells us who we are
- Anonymous
